http://www.scarboromissions.ca/Golden_rule/sacred_texts.php

The Golden Rule Across the World's Religions
Thirteen Sacred Texts - English Version

[b]Bahá'í Faith

Lay not on any soul a load that you would not wish to be laid upon you, and desire not for anyone the things you would not desire for yourself.

Bahá'u'lláh, Gleanings

Buddhi ...[text shortened]... b]
Do not do unto others whatever is injurious to yourself.

Shayast-na-Shayast 13.29
